Transaction 8149cf6bf64ebe45e69b5547edc7d01fb41a5f64b23803a948d055c60113d9aa

1 Input
2 Outputs
  • 8149cf6bf64ebe45e69b5547edc7d01fb41a5f64b23803a948d055c60113d9aa:0
  • value  370520
    address  394TwPma13U8dVFGKG2BRYcVYggQRxnx3z
  • 8149cf6bf64ebe45e69b5547edc7d01fb41a5f64b23803a948d055c60113d9aa:1
  • value  70079287
    address  3CQGbV6he7iyRCijd61vz7P2ScxxUCiYn1